How much does an assembly technician earn in Matthews, NC?

The average assembly technician in Matthews, NC earns between $26,000 and $40,000 annually. This compares to the national average assembly technician range of $28,000 to $43,000.

Average assembly technician salary in Matthews, NC

$32,000
